How they compare
Côte d’Ivoire currently reports 2.45 against 2.44 in Guinea, a difference of 0.01.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 74 shared years of data; in 1950 it was Côte d’Ivoire ahead.
Côte d’Ivoire ranks 26th and Guinea ranks 28th of 229 countries.
Across the 8 decades both report, Côte d’Ivoire averaged higher in 7 and Guinea in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Côte d’Ivoire | Guinea |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 2.9 | 1.65 | 1.25 | Côte d’Ivoire |
| 1960s | 3.84 | 1.84 | 2 | Côte d’Ivoire |
| 1970s | 4.19 | 1.66 | 2.54 | Côte d’Ivoire |
| 1980s | 3.94 | 2.3 | 1.64 | Côte d’Ivoire |
| 1990s | 3.79 | 2.83 | 0.9631 | Côte d’Ivoire |
| 2000s | 2.42 | 2.06 | 0.359 | Côte d’Ivoire |
| 2010s | 2.5 | 2.51 | 0.0141 | Guinea |
| 2020s | 2.49 | 2.48 | 0.005 | Côte d’Ivoire |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
